Pelican/Coleman canoe seat separation
"Steve Cramer" wrote in message ... Steve B. wrote: http://www.lauche-maas.de/suche_seit...toffboote.html 785 Euros / US$1000 is cheap? Cheap? It's freaking outrageous. Those things go for US$569 over here. http://www.dickssportinggoods.com/pr...Id=18785218842 What does a good ABS canoe (aka Canadian) cost in Germany? Wilko, any info from the Netherlands? Steve -- Steve Cramer Athens, GA Looking at a retailer in Germany, the 16 foot Old Town Penobscot goes for around 1500 Euros, or nearly 1900 USD. The exchange rate is the killer, and it doesn't look to improve. You don't know how good you've got it over there, both for price and assortment. Ebay is an alternative, sometimes with paddles and PFDs thrown in: http://sport.listings.ebay.at/Ruder-...istingItemList Steve B. Lake Wolfgang near Salzburg |
